The 3rd annual medical conference of the Iraqi Medical Society International was held in London on Saturday 1/10/2011 in the presence of more than 200 members of the society. On 8th March 09 the Society met in Imperial College London in the presence of a delegation from Iraq. The scientific programme discussed several important subjects. The first speaker was Dr Abbas Latif, Consultant Paediatrician.
